What Are Envelope Dimensions?

Envelope size is usually defined by length × height. It tells you what size of paper or item can fit inside.
Most envelopes are designed to match standard paper sizes like A4, A5, or letters.

Common Envelope Sizes

Here are some widely used envelope sizes:
DL Envelope

Size: 110 × 220 mm

Best for: Folded A4 letters (in thirds)

Common use: Business letters, invoices

C4 Envelope

Size: 229 × 324 mm

Best for: A4 documents without folding

Common use: Official documents, certificates

C5 Envelope

Size: 162 × 229 mm

Best for: A5 documents or folded A4

Common use: Invitations, letters

C6 Envelope

Size: 114 × 162 mm

Best for: A6 cards

Common use: Greeting cards, small invites

A4 Envelope

Size: 9 × 12 inches (approx.)

Best for: Full-size documents

Common use: Legal papers, reports

Types of Envelopes

Different types of envelopes are designed for specific purposes.

Standard Envelopes

Used for everyday mailing like letters and documents.

Window Envelopes

Have a transparent window to show the address inside. Common for bills and invoices.

Padded Envelopes

Include bubble lining for extra protection. Best for fragile or small items.

Rigid Envelopes

Made from thick material to prevent bending. Ideal for important documents or photos.

Catalog Envelopes

Large envelopes used for brochures, magazines, or bulk documents.
Square Envelopes
Stylish and unique, often used for invitations and special occasions.

Choosing the Right Envelope Size

To select the right envelope, consider:

Size of your document

Whether folding is acceptable

Level of protection needed

Purpose (business, personal, or promotional)

Using the correct size improves presentation and avoids damage.
Tips for Better Envelope Use

Always match envelope size with document size

Use padded envelopes for delicate items

Avoid overfilling to prevent tearing

Choose quality material for a professional look

These simple tips help improve mailing efficiency.
